Product reviews:
Quennel
2026-02-24 iphone X
Marvel Avengers 20-piece Mega Figurine mega figurine set avengers
mega figurine set avengers
Mandel
2026-02-27 iphone SE
The Avengers Disney Store Marvel Mega mega figurine set avengers
mega figurine set avengers
Sid
2026-02-22 iphone 7 Plus
Disney Marvel Avengers Mega Figurine mega figurine set avengers
mega figurine set avengers
Stanford
2026-02-22 iphone 7
Disney Marvel Avengers Mega Figurine mega figurine set avengers
mega figurine set avengers